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92 613759 566825444 0041934 3334567351
21182 55705
21182 55705
96 558 11599308691 14934
All about undefined
Interested in learning more?
21182 55705
96 558 11599308691 14934
See more
18113257494 36325520
81292298 879414 72 19834727
See more
68603 02124595487 16336415356
87956279239 682945 63
See more